All I can say is OMG. You have some of the best potential sites for detecting near you. The Burlington/Ocean Co border has some of the richest history in the area! Route 9 dates back to a time when no one had ventured beyond the Mississippi! I bet if you just take a walk on one of the many wooded paths off of it you will find tons of old treasure. There are likely to be old homesteads on Route 9 that are not just wooded lots.

My advice would be to go to the Ocean Co library and start looking at old maps and books. Read books on what to look for when metal detecting. Use Google Earth to investigate possible sites. Knocking on doors is a great idea too!

DO THE RESEARCH!
